The way clinical psychology is taught at EUR allows students to get insights into the different areas within clinical psychology rooted in recent research. The courses are coordinated and taught by professors who have wide experiences in the field, as researchers as well as clinicians.

After my positive experience with the teaching standards and the international environment at EUR as a bachelor student in psychology, I decided to also undertake the master’s programme of clinical psychology. During this master programme, courses cover a variety of very interesting topics which are presented in different formats helping to acquire consolidated knowledge throughout the year. Furthermore, the clinical specialisation offers a great combination of theory and practice. Lectures with interesting guest speakers sharing their experiences, excursions to the court or forensic psychiatry, and practicals in which methods of therapy techniques are practiced, help to deepen and broaden the theoretical knowledge. The master program is taught in the form of problem-based learning. Although reading scientific literature at home or at the library requires a good amount of discipline, discussing it with fellow students is an enriching experience. Moreover, discussions with international students coming from different cultural backgrounds, add an interesting and stimulating aspect to the interactive learning experience. Additionally, due to the small teaching groups, students are able to gain a lot more of the expertise the professors are able to offer.

Alongside the master’s, EUR offers flexibility in terms of research opportunities and internships. An advanced research programme is offered to students of all psychology master tracks, which is a great opportunity for anyone with an interest in scientific research. Since all courses take place in the first semester, it is possible to start an internship in the second semester in the Netherlands, but also abroad.
